MiniGui build 25.06

226 views
Skip to first unread message

Pedro Chanis

unread,
Jun 5, 2025, 1:51:07 PM6/5/25
to Harbour Minigui
Al ejecutar el programa generado con este build genera un checkstatic.txt archivo que relentiza la salida del programa con un error de excepcion, eso ocurre desde el build 25.05 con esto quiero decir que los errores persisten.

Grigory Filatov

unread,
Jun 5, 2025, 2:04:31 PM6/5/25
to Harbour Minigui
Hello Elias,

There is no error here as the Standard build is for DEBUGGING only.
This build is NOT recommended for production use.

Please refer to the following detailed explanation.

---

🔧 Key Differences Between Pro and Standard Builds

Standard Build:

* Free to download and use.
* Includes a debug version of the MiniGUI library.
* Utilizes the standard Harbour compiler without optimizations.
* Excludes sample applications, utilities, and the SQLRDD library.

Pro Build:

* Available exclusively to donors.
* Features a compressed MiniGUI library without debugging information.
* Employs an optimized Harbour virtual machine tailored for GUI applications.
* Includes advanced components such as the SQLRDD library, sample applications, and utilities.
* Supports additional compilers like MinGW C (32-bit and 64-bit) and Embarcadero C++ 7.70 for Win32.

---

✅ Reasons to Choose the Pro Build

1. Enhanced Performance:

   * The optimized Harbour VM in the Pro build offers better execution speed and efficiency for GUI applications.

2. Access to Advanced Features:

   * Inclusion of the SQLRDD library facilitates integration with various SQL servers like MySQL, PostgreSQL, Firebird, Oracle, and MS SQL.
   * Provides additional sample applications and utilities to accelerate development.

3. Broader Compiler Support:

   * Compatibility with multiple compilers allows for greater flexibility in development environments.

---

💡 Conclusion

If your development requires optimized performance, advanced database integration, and access to a broader set of tools and features, the Pro MiniGUI build is the preferable choice. However, for basic applications or initial development phases, the Standard build may suffice.

Hope this is clear now.

Best regards,
Grigory Filatov
MiniGUI Development Team

четверг, 5 июня 2025 г. в 19:51:07 UTC+2, elias...@gmail.com:

Adam Lubszczyk

unread,
Jun 8, 2025, 1:12:01 PM6/8/25
to Harbour Minigui
Hello Pedro

Unfortunately, the authors went the Microsoft way and added features to the free version that make it harder to use.

I  already gave You a workaround for this in version 25.05 (overwriting the ALTD() function). 
Unfortunately, the authors read this group and blocked this workaround in version 25.06 -make static function _altd()  :-( 

Of course, there are other simple workarounds, but I can't provide them here because they'll be blocked again.

You have the sources, so you can figure out a way to get around these f... restrictions.
Hint: Look in the sources for function calls: CheckStatic() and Set( _SET_DEBUG ...)

Adam

Anand K Gupta

unread,
Jun 8, 2025, 2:02:15 PM6/8/25
to Adam Lubszczyk, Harbour Minigui

After war, Grigory had to leave for another country.
He had been providing full free version earlier, but life changed for no fault of his.
He has to resort to this method to keep going.
Please understand.

Anand 📱

--
Visit our website on https://www.hmgextended.com/ or https://www.hmgextended.org/
---
You received this message because you are subscribed to the Google Groups "Harbour Minigui" group.
To unsubscribe from this group and stop receiving emails from it, send an email to minigui-foru...@googlegroups.com.
To view this discussion, visit https://groups.google.com/d/msgid/minigui-forum/37598768-68f1-47f9-98ea-162ebf76b6d8n%40googlegroups.com.

Krzysztof Stankiewicz

unread,
Jun 9, 2025, 3:39:40 AM6/9/25
to Harbour Minigui
Hello everyone,
To be honest I don't understand either.
At some point running the update from version 23 caused all collected LIB, DLL files and example directories to disappear ?!!!.
At first I thought it was a virus, after some time I realized it was intentional.
I had previously paid $200 and would probably have paid more, but in this situation I feel forced to pay a fixed fee.
In a word, this is not a free project with donors but a normal sale of a product with a free, heavily limited demo version.

Krzysztof Stankiewicz

unread,
Jun 9, 2025, 3:51:37 AM6/9/25
to Harbour Minigui
Too bad,
Acting by surprise and pretending that it is still a free language based on Clipper.

Maybe it would be better to set a single rate for purchasing the commercial version so that in the future we are not surprised by such radical changes.

Anand Gupta

unread,
Jun 9, 2025, 3:06:29 PM6/9/25
to Krzysztof Stankiewicz, Harbour Minigui
We have to accept now that "MiniGUI Extended" is a paid product.
Though Grigory accepts any donation, the recommendation is something 50$ AFAIK.

He can stop giving the free version which is of little use now.

Please see how much work he does behind the screen for all the new and enhanced features of MG Ex. If we benefit from it, we should help and encourage him.

Regards,

Anand


José Roberto

unread,
Jun 9, 2025, 7:24:20 PM6/9/25
to Anand Gupta, Krzysztof Stankiewicz, Harbour Minigui

Boa Noite a todos!

Gostaria de fazer uma pergunta: Na versão extendida, teremos funções para notas fiscais, cupons fiscais e a comunicação com a fazenda?


Reply all
Reply to author
Forward
0 new messages